Obverse description Central device depicts the Chinthe, the mythical lion-guardian of Burmese royal tradition, shown passant in high relief with detailed mane, raised forepaw, and curled tail, set upon a plain ground line. Burmese numerals and script legends are arranged in the field surrounding the Chinthe, with the Burmese era date ၁၂၄၀ (1240, corresponding to 1879 CE) inscribed in the lower field. The entire design is contained within a dentilated border running along the coin's rim.
